Magda Remillard
Vice President, Operations
Magda Remillard has most recently
been involved with building out of
the Business Development unit at
Novatel Wireless, focusing on value
add applications for Novatel's core
business in 3G modems. Before
joining Novatel, Ms Remillard
founded Zaxis Technologies, a mobile
software company that developed
porting technologies enabling mobile
applications to function on all cell
phones. During her tenure, she
raised $550K of private equity to
fund the company’s product
development efforts. In 2004, as CEO
of Zaxis, she was named as one of
the finalists for the prestigious
Athena Pinnacle awards. Prior to
that, Ms Remillard worked at another
San Diego start up, PRAJA Inc, where
she ran the IT, Software QA, Project
Management, and Customer Support
areas.
Before joining PRAJA, Ms
Remillard served as Director of Live
Systems at Golfsat.com where she was
responsible for the management of
Software QA, Software CM, and the
Application Support groups and
launched the Golfsat.com site in
September 2000. Before Golfsat, she
was part of the team at Gateway
eCommerce where she created and ran
the Software QA department. Her
first Internet related experience
was at PersonaLogic, Inc., a
Web-based e commerce navigation
company, which America Online
acquired in November 1998. She also
held several IT management positions
within the Savings and Loan and
Mortgage Banking industry.
Ms Remillard received her B.A. from the
University of California, San Diego.
She was born and raised in Poland
and came to the United States at the
age 13. In 1978 she moved to San
Diego to attend UCSD and remained
here to pursue her career and family
life. In addition to her business
and family activities, Ms. Remillard
is involved in her community and
served 3 years as Business Area 1
Representative of the Executive
Board of University Community
Planning Group.
